The New York Knicks reportedly sign point guard Chris Duhon
The Knicks have reportedly signed free agent point guard Chris Duhon to a 2-year, $12 million dollar contract. I have to wonder if the Knicks are smoking something in the front office as Duhon has never been good enough to hold a starting job in the NBA. It appears as if the Knicks will likely try to get rid of Stephon Marbury and make Duhon the starter at point guard and that is a recipe for disaster. Duhon played in 66 games (18 starts) with the Bulls last season and he averaged 22.6 minutes, 5.8 points, 1.8 rebounds and 4.0 assists per game. Duhon has now played in 300 games (159 starts) in his NBA career and he has averaged 25.8 minutes, 6.9 points, 2.4 rebounds and 4.5 assists per game. But, Duhon is not a good shooter as he has only hit 38.7% of his field goal attempts in his NBA career. This was another poor move for the Knicks if they are planning on starting Duhon.
